仓库修改寄售功能代码提交

ywj_dev
郑明梁 2 years ago
parent 6f673f4449
commit 2fa57459a7

@ -169,7 +169,7 @@
<el-row :gutter="20" class="el-row" type="flex"> <el-row :gutter="20" class="el-row" type="flex">
<el-col :span="12" class="el-col"> <el-col :span="12" class="el-col">
<el-form-item label="寄售仓库" prop="advanceType" class="query-form-item"> <el-form-item label="寄售仓库" prop="advanceType" class="query-form-item">
<el-radio-group v-model="subData.advanceType"> <el-radio-group :disabled="isAdvanceTypeShow" v-model="subData.advanceType">
<el-radio :label="false">非寄售</el-radio> <el-radio :label="false">非寄售</el-radio>
<el-radio :label="true">寄售</el-radio> <el-radio :label="true">寄售</el-radio>
</el-radio-group> </el-radio-group>
@ -387,6 +387,7 @@ export default {
// page: 1, // page: 1,
// limit: 10, // limit: 10,
}, },
isAdvanceTypeShow:false,
isShow:false, isShow:false,
loading: true, loading: true,
list: [], list: [],
@ -485,17 +486,21 @@ export default {
if (formName === "edit") { if (formName === "edit") {
this.subData = JSON.parse(JSON.stringify(data)); this.subData = JSON.parse(JSON.stringify(data));
if(this.subData.parentCode!=null && this.subData.parentCode!=""){ if(this.subData.parentCode!=null && this.subData.parentCode!=""){
this.isAdvanceTypeShow=true;
this.isShow=false; this.isShow=false;
}else{ }else{
this.isAdvanceTypeShow=false;
this.isShow=true this.isShow=true
this.subData.parentCode=null; this.subData.parentCode=null;
} }
} else if (formName === "add") { } else if (formName === "add") {
this.isShow=true this.isShow=true
if(data==null){ if(data==null){
this.isAdvanceTypeShow=false;
this.subData = {advanceType: false, spUse: false,parentCode:null}; this.subData = {advanceType: false, spUse: false,parentCode:null};
}else{ }else{
this.subData = {advanceType: false, spUse: false,parentCode:data.code}; this.isAdvanceTypeShow=true;
this.subData = {advanceType: data.advanceType, spUse: false,parentCode:data.code};
} }
} }
this.subFormVisible = true; this.subFormVisible = true;

Loading…
Cancel
Save